At CES,LG showcased their new Touch Watch Phone, the LG-GD910. Apart from looking straight out of a Dick Tracy movie, the phone features 3G connectivity, comes equipped with a touchscreen and is housed in a metal casing.

T-Mobile has unveiled their winter line up and looks like there is something for everyone. So in the coming weeks, expect the debut of handsets like the HTC Shadow, the Nokia 7510, Motorola W233 Renew and the Samsung T119.

The Sony Ericsson C510 Cyber-shot, which got unveiled at CES features Smile Shutter™ technology that is present in Sony digicams. The candy bar styled phone features a 3.2 megapixel camera in addition to Youtube support and Face Detection technology.

Apple unveiled the new and improved iTunes Store at Macworld Expo. For iPhone 3G users this translates to OTA downloads on the 3G network and a DRM free music catalogue. For more information head over here.
